The latest wave of high-precision strikes targeted drone assembly facilities and other military-linked sites, the Defense Ministry in Moscow has said
The Russian military has carried out a series of strikes on Ukrainian military-related targets in response to “terrorist” raids by Kiev deep into Russia, the Defense Ministry in Moscow has said.
In a statement on Friday, the ministry said its forces had launched a massive strike overnight in retaliation for “the terrorist acts of the Kiev regime,” adding that it involved long-range precision weapons, Kinzhal air-based hypersonic missiles, and drones.
The attack targeted industrial enterprises developing and producing drones and other robotic mobile systems, facilities manufacturing various military equipment in Kiev, as well as a military airfield and an oil refinery in an undisclosed location, officials said.
“The goal of the strike has been achieved. All designated facilities have been hit,” the ministry added.
